at this point, the only things that really bother me (and I think at least some of you will agree with me) should be changed. specifically-
Episode I-reshoot Bail Organa's scenes with Jimmy smitts and add them back in. add all the deleted scenes back in.
Episode II-add anakin's chace through the rescue party graveyard back into the movie, finish the space battle and add it back into the movie, add back all the deleted scenes.
episode III-whatever deleted scenes apply
episode IV-retouch all the lightsabers, especially in the obi-wan/vader duel, get rid of all the english text and numerals, rearrange the soundtrack (already done), fix CGI Jabba, redub the troopers with Tem Morrison, let Han shoot first, add whatever deleted scenes apply
episode V-smooth out the Walkers and Taun Tauns, refilm Palpatine with Ian Mcdiarmond, rearrange the soundtrack (may already be done) redub Boba and the troopers with Tem Morrison, add the deleted wampa subplot back in, add any deleted scenes that apply, resynch luke's lips and back in the original "your lucky you didn't taste good" line in the artoo gets swallowed scene
Episode VI:redub the troops and Boba with Temura Morrison, fix the rancor, show boba with no helmet at least once (ala infinities-ESB), add all applicable deleted scenes back in, especially vader's confrontation with the red guard, rearrange the music (may already be done ), get rid of the splotches on palpatines head, add the prequal planets to the fireworks show-Naboo, Utapau, Aquilia, Geonosis, Kamino, Kashyyk (and maybe the clone war planets-Illum, Muunilist, Mon Calamari, Dantooine, and Rattatak?), finally, add episode III hayden Christiansen to the ghost scene, Sebastion Shaw looks nothing like Anakin at all, same goes for the death scene-maybe...
There, that's really not much, is it? a lot of it is fixing technical glitches.
